Identifying characteristics that enable resilient immunisation programmes: a scoping review

The COVID-19 pandemic revealed weaknesses in vaccination programs, leading to reduced vaccination rates and disease outbreaks. This study identifies key characteristics of resilient immunization programs to inform the development of a new assessment tool.
Area of Science:
- Public Health
- Health Systems Research
- Epidemiology
Background:
- The COVID-19 pandemic exposed significant vulnerabilities in global immunization programs, resulting in decreased vaccination coverage and increased outbreaks of vaccine-preventable diseases.
- The need for robust and resilient immunization programs capable of functioning effectively during crises is paramount.
- Currently, no established framework exists for evaluating the resilience of immunization programs.
Purpose of the Study:
- To conduct a scoping review of immunization programs during crises to identify factors contributing to their resilience.
- To inform the development of an Immunisation Programme Resilience Tool.
Main Methods:
- A scoping review was conducted following the Arksey and O'Malley framework.
- Searches were performed across multiple databases (CINAHL, CENTRAL, Embase, Google Scholar, MEDLINE, PsycINFO, Web of Science) from January 2011 to September 2023.
- Thirty-seven empirical, peer-reviewed studies on immunization program resilience during crises were included and synthesized.
Main Results:
- Five core characteristics of resilient immunization programs were identified, drawing from the Health System Resilience Index: Integration, Awareness, Resource Availability and Access, Adaptiveness, and Self-regulation.
- The reviewed studies spanned six continents, with a notable concentration in Africa, Asia, and Europe.
- Several evidence gaps in the literature regarding immunization program resilience were identified.
Conclusions:
- No existing tool assesses immunization program resilience.
- The identified characteristics, derived from the Health System Resilience Index and empirical evidence, provide a foundation for developing a novel Immunisation Programme Resilience Tool.
- This tool could enhance the capacity of immunization programs to withstand and recover from various crises.
